As the founder of Write Direction Tutoring, I’m passionate about helping individuals become confident, capable thinkers. I work with people across a wide spectrum of academic needs—from strengthening writing and reading comprehension to cultivating effective study habits. What inspires me most is witnessing others discover their voice, gain clarity, and take pride in their progress.
My approach is warm, structured, and deeply personalized. I believe everyone deserves support tailored to their unique starting point. Whether a learner needs help organizing ideas, navigating complex texts, strengthening writing skills, or managing assignments, I offer patient guidance, practical strategies, and consistent encouragement.
I hold degrees in Business Education and a Master’s in Human Resources Leadership, along with certifications as a Master Instructional Designer and Master Trainer. These credentials reflect my commitment to evidence-based instruction and real-world relevance. Above all, I bring a genuine love for learning and a steadfast dedication to helping those I work with thrive.
